Cost

Window screen replacement costs can differ based on the type of window screens purchased and the size of the windows being replaced. It is also important to consider the cost of installation and labor when estimating your project's total costs.

The most important aspect to consider when selecting window replacement near me screens is the material. Aluminum and fiberglass are two of the most popular options for window screens, however each comes with its own advantages and disadvantages. For example fiberglass is the most affordable alternative, but it does stretch and tear easily. Aluminum is more durable than fiberglass, but it can also scratch and require painting.

Other factors that impact cost include the type of screen material as well as any additional features that you want to include with your new windows, like sound reduction or UV protection capabilities. These options can raise your initial costs but they will save you money in the long run by reducing your energy bills and minimizing replacement and repair costs.

Another aspect to be aware of is the climate where you live. It is important to do some research prior to buying screens. Some screens may not be suitable for the climate where you live. For instance, coastal regions often require materials that are resistant to saltwater and corrosion. Furthermore, windy areas can cause debris to fly that can damage standard screen materials. Tuff screens are an excellent choice for these climates because they are made to resist damage from debris and weather.

You can also cut down on window screen replacement costs by rescreening instead replacing the existing frames. Rescreening is an excellent option if your existing frame is in good shape and isn't showing signs of being warped or buckling. Rescreening is an option if you select a material that fits the opening size of your frame.

Maintenance

Window screens are a great method to keep insects out of your home. They won't last forever, and require regular maintenance. The most typical signs that your windows need screen repair are holes in the frame or mesh, pet damage or the aging. Window screen replacement is a simple DIY project that requires a few tools and Window screen replacement supplies, including the utility knife, the spline roller, the replacement screen material, and the proper spline.

Remove the old screen. Remove any clips or tabs that hold the screen in place and place it on a flat surface. Utilize a flat-head screw to pry out the screen spline out of the channel around the frame's perimeter. If the spline is in good condition, you can reuse it, but throw away or reuse screens that have been damaged. Clean the screen frame before installing it again.

After the frame has been cleaned and is ready to receive the new screens, it's the time to measure the replacements. The spline that you replace should be slightly longer than the previous one. The spline will expand when you insert it into the channel to ensure the security of your new screen. It is also important to purchase a spline that is the same width as the original screen.

Some windows have tension mounts instead of channels, and aren't as prone to bend when you remove or install the screen. If your screen is sliding out of the frame it is most likely because the tension mounting is loose or spring clips are removed.
